Dead man found positive for swine flu

Lucknow A 40-year-old man, Jatin Prasad (40), who died on July 24 at the SGPGI, has tested positive for the H1N1 virus. The test results came after his death.

Prasad, a resident of Badaun, was admitted to SGPGI on July 12 with a number of problems including multiple organ damage due to diabetes. Shifted to the Endocrinology ward on July 14, he suffered a cardiac arrest, after which he was shifted to the Intensive Care Unit.

“He was a chronic smoker and alcoholic and was also being treated for tuberculosis,” said Prof AK Baronia, Head of the Department of Critical Care Medicine and In Charge of the ICU. He had severe septic shock, and failed kidneys and infection in lungs. “After his death, tests showed that he was H1N1 positive. But there were multiple causes for his death and it cannot be completely attributed to H1N1,” Baronia added. The case is yet to be reported as a swine flu death at the H1N1 control room.
